How do you add figures to an APA paper?

Placement of Figures in a Paper There are two options for the placement of figures (and tables) in a paper. The first is to embed figures in the text after each is first mentioned (or called out); the second is to place each figure on a separate page after the reference list.

How do you prove anything in statistics?

Statistics can never “prove” anything. All a statistical test can do is assign a probability to the data you have, indicating the likelihood (or probability) that these numbers come from random fluctuations in sampling.

What are the benefits of a nurse residency program?

These programs are designed to support newly hired graduate nurses as they transition to their first professional nursing position. Residency programs focus on building decision-making skills, reducing burnout, developing clinical leadership, and incorporating research into nursing practice.

Whats the difference between a resident and a fellow?

Resident physicians have completed medical school and have earned an M.D. degree. They practice medicine in a supervised setting for three years to complete training in general internal medicine. Fellows have completed an internal medicineresidency and are pursuing further training in internal medicine subspecialties.

What’s the difference between a fellowship and residency?

Often, the residency experience prepares an individual to become a board-certified clinical specialist. A fellowship is designed for the graduate of a residency or board-certified therapist to focus on a subspecialty area of clinical practice, education, or research.

What problems do hackers cause?

Hacking often results in a loss of data due to files being deleted or changed. Customer information and order information can be stolen and deleted, or a leak of top secret information could cause real-world security issues.

What happens if a company is hacked?

Once inside, hackers can gain access to a firm’s data, encrypt it and demand a ransom to unlock it. In most situations, the detection software alerts the company to a breach and then the incident response team works with the client to mitigate the threat.

What was coal used for in the Industrial Revolution?

Coal was king of the British Industrial Revolution. As coke, it provided an efficient fuel for reliably turning iron ore into iron.

What was coal used for in the 1800s?

People began using coal in the 1800s to heat their homes. Trains and ships used coal for fuel. Factories used coal to make iron and steel. Today, we burn coal mainly to make electricity.

What coal is used for?

The most significant uses of coal are in electricity generation, steel production, cement manufacturing and as a liquid fuel. Different types of coal have different uses. Steam coal - also known as thermal coal - is mainly used in power generation.

How did coal change the world?

The discovery of coal’s very high heat potential drastically changed society from the end of the 18th century. Both a source of energy and a fuel, coal was the key driver for the industrial revolution. Its use on a massive scale transformed an agricultural society into an industrial one.

What is a disadvantage of coal?

The major disadvantage of coal is its negative impact on the environment. Coal-burning energy plants are a major source of air pollution and greenhouse gas emissions. In addition to carbon monoxide and heavy metals like mercury, the use of coal releases sulfur dioxide, a harmful substance linked to acid rain.

Why is coal the cheapest energy source?

Coal is only considered cheap because coal plants do not have to pay for the full social and environmental costs of coal burning on people’s health, the natural environment, and our climate. Wind power is now cheaper than coal in many markets; in the United States it’s now half the price of existing coal plants.
